UPVFC Defeats Morrdh 2-1 to Grab DienCup I Championship Title
Jennifer Dimasalang | 15 December 2018, 9:10 AM PST

Match Highlights:
  • Magtibay (34:56) and Katigbak (100:43) seal the deal for Palmyrion
  • Morridane team the only team to break Palmyrion's defense for 1 goal
  • Graduating roster thankful for their very first international championship title



Kort Kaster, Fedala, The Golden Throne | In perhaps the most spectacular and breathtaking match of the tournament, Palmyrion steams through the Morridane ranks to grab the DienCup I championship title - undefeated. However, the Morridanes were able to break through the defenses of the University of Palmyrion Varsity Football Club (known as the Maroon Strikers) to answer Magtibay's opening goal with the sole Morridane goal of the match on the second half, with a 1-1 tie at the end of regulation time. Katigbak, however, managed to seal the deal for Palmyrion with a goal at 10:43 of the extra time match.

"The Maroon Strikers have triumphed over the odds to secure a championship title not only for UP, but also for the entirety of the Royal Commonwealth. As their coach, I am very proud of our team. This is truly the spirit of Atin 'To." head coach Caballero said during a post-match interview. "The game may have gone well into overtime, but the extra 15 minutes was all worth it. Palmyrion is now gaining visibility in the international scene after three decades of being just another relatively reclusive trade partner." he added.

While UP students were at their plentiest during the match, they were not the sole fans of the UP Varsity Football Club; fans from all over the world expressed their admiration for the emergent underdog team representing Palmyrion. "Maybe next time I may want to study in the University of Palmyrion, and maybe get to cheer for them as a UP student. It's sad though, that this is most likely their last appearance in DienCup, but as a student cheering for them in the PCAL, I would be very ecstatic at the prospect. UP Fight!" a Morridane fan in the match said - and he is correct about this being UPVFC's last DienCup appearance.

For the ten graduating players of UPVFC, the future holds a high degree of uncertainty - but there are talks of them of either joining the Palmyrian national football team, or forming a certain "Katipunan FC" with their Ateneo Lu-Bruska (ALB) counterparts.
